How to convert eps to igs file

You can probably find programs that can directly convert Encapsulated PostScript graphics (.eps) to IGES CAD format (.igs) with several commercial CAD programs. However, you may also try to convert eps to dwg, which can then be converted further to IGS with some dwg to igs converter.

Understanding EPS and IGS file formats

EPS (Encapsulated PostScript) is a graphics file format used for vector images. It is widely used in the publishing industry for high-resolution graphics and illustrations. EPS files can contain both text and graphics, and they are often used for printing purposes due to their scalability and high quality.

IGS (Initial Graphics Exchange Specification) is a file format used for exchanging 3D models and designs between different CAD (Computer-Aided Design) systems. It is a neutral file format that allows for the transfer of geometric data, making it a popular choice for engineers and designers working with 3D models.

Converting EPS to IGS

Converting an EPS file to an IGS file involves transforming a 2D vector image into a 3D model format. This process is essential for designers and engineers who need to incorporate 2D graphics into 3D CAD projects.

Best software for EPS to IGS conversion

One of the best software options for converting EPS to IGS is Autodesk AutoCAD. AutoCAD is a powerful CAD software that supports a wide range of file formats, including EPS and IGS. To convert an EPS file to IGS in AutoCAD, follow these steps:

  • Open AutoCAD and import the EPS file using the File → Import menu.
  • Once the EPS file is imported, use the 3D modeling tools to create a 3D representation of the 2D image.
  • After creating the 3D model, export it as an IGS file using the File → Export → IGS option.

Another option is CorelDRAW, which can also handle EPS files and export them to formats compatible with 3D modeling software, although it may require additional steps to convert to IGS.
